Position Details
What You Will Do
- Manage complex IT application development and infrastructure projects.
- Define and be accountable for the project - scope, schedule, budget, quality and project management plan.
- Monitor the budget, keep track of actual cost monthly, and initiate corrective actions before variances exceed approved thresholds.
- Ensure project delivery is as per standards and best practices defined in CCG’s project management framework.
- Provide project management direction and guidance to teams, adhering to proven project management methodologies including Scrum agile.
- Create winning IT strategies to achieve the project goals and deliver all the mandates of the business case driving the project.
- Develop and support innovative solutions to meet the needs of the business and align the solution with the existing system architecture capabilities.
- Act as a communications conduit to business stakeholders/partners to ascertain the project is fulfilling the business needs.
- Monitor and respond swiftly to issues, risks, and decisions; escalate issues promptly when necessary.
- Management of project resources in collaboration with the functional managers/directors.
- Provide regular status updates to sponsors, stakeholders, steering committee members, C-level executives regarding progress and emerging issues.
- Establish performance measures for project members and provide meaningful and timely feedback.
- Realize the pulse of the project team(s) and keep team morale elevated.
Who You Are
- Must be a team player with an intrapreneurship mindset.
- Hands on, seasoned, and well-organized professional with effective time management skills.
- Can rally her/his team to focus on quality delivery, pays attention to the right details.
- Bachelor’s degree in computer science or an analytical discipline.
- 7+ years of dedicated IT project management experience.
- Successfully managed and delivered complex IT projects (i.e., digital transformation, multi-year, multiple phases/deliverables, with cross functional dependencies, across lines of businesses etc.).
- Possess robust project management knowledge, practical technical knowledge, and strong business management skills.
- Excellent foundational skills in project management life cycle and with tools such as Microsoft Project, JIRA etc.
- Ability to multi-task and have resilience in dealing with shifting priorities or operating in an uncertain environment when all the details are not established (e.g., during the initiation phase).
- Solid leader who can rally teams towards the vision, mission, goals of the organization with ease.
- Ability to influence without authority through negotiation, interpersonal skills, and motivation skills.
- Strong ability to inspire others to build high performance teams and achieve extraordinary results in a fast paced (and rewarding) work culture
- Exemplary communications skills specifically in communicating complex/technical information to a wide audience.
- Experience with handling steering committee meetings and presenting succinct status to project sponsors.
- Experienced in creating SOW, contracts, and managing vendors.
- Strong understanding of technology concepts including SOA architecture, web services, data exchange standards, mobile development, data warehouse, B2B/B2C systems etc.
- Project Management Professional (PMP) certification an asset.
- Certified Scrum Master designation is an asset.
- Guidewire product knowledge is an asset.
- SAP product knowledge is an asset.
